This isn't a traditional Christmas collection. It's a book about life — about the lessons we learn in childhood and carry with us into adulthood, about the enduring belief that good ultimately wins, and about the invisible thread that connects generations.
This is a book about our heritage and roots. It features the bird Potya, the Heavenly Egg, and the magic mirror. Folklorist Maria Kvitka has read hundreds of fairy tales to select those that resonate most with modern readers. These stories guide us gently back to ourselves.
The collection features stories from various regions of Ukraine and different centuries of our history.
A luminous journey through Ukraine’s folklore, Skyward Tree gathers timeless tales that reveal the nation’s resilient spirit and rich imagination. From Kyiv to distant regions, fearless heroes, wise elders, and daring princesses traverse landscapes steeped in legend. Culminating in the titular tale—a soaring metaphor for hope—this collection is a living testament to cultural memory and identity.
